Phoenix Criminal Defense Law Firm Announces Autism Scholarship
The Feldman Law Firm and its founder, Adam Feldman, have announced they will be offering a $1,000 educational scholarship open to anyone who has been diagnosed with autism. The scholarship is designed to inspire those individuals to further their education, and both Mr. Feldman and the staff of the entire firm are hopeful that it will provide a measure of encouragement to those who might otherwise discontinue their studies after high school.
PHOENIX, April 2, 2019 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- The Feldman Law Firm, a Phoenix criminal defense firm, and its founder, Adam Feldman, have announced that they will be offering a tuition scholarship for individuals with Autism Spectrum Disorder (autism/ASD). The scholarship, which will be in the amount of $1,000, will be applied to the payment of tuition at a post-secondary school (college or trade school). The program is open those currently attending school, as well as those who are not currently enrolled.
Mr. Feldman believes that the program will provide an additional opportunity to those who have been diagnosed with ASD. The tuition assistance scholarship is being offered not only to help the successful applicant continue with his or her education, but also as encouragement to those who might otherwise decide not to pursue and reach their educational goals.
If you are Interested in the scholarship, more information is available on the firm's website, including the online application, the selection process, and related issues. The deadline for the submission of applications is February 21, 2020.
